The drive from Owen Sound to Walkerton is a 60-kilometer trip southwest along Highway 4. The journey typically takes 50 minutes, passing through the scenic landscape of Grey and Bruce Counties. Walkerton is a charming town known for its historic downtown and the Saugeen River. This route is a primary artery for commuters and travelers moving between the Georgian Bay area and the interior of the province.
Total Distance: 60 km driving distance; 50 km straight-line air distance.
